Another groundbreaking technology pioneered by biopharma process systems limited is single-use bioprocessing systems. Traditionally, bioprocess equipment is made of stainless steel and requires extensive cleaning and validation processes between batches. However, single-use systems are made of disposable plastic components that can be easily replaced after each use, eliminating the need for cleaning and reducing the risk of cross-contamination. This not only saves time and resources but also allows for greater flexibility and scalability in biopharmaceutical production.
In addition to automation and single-use technologies, biopharma process systems limited also specializes in continuous bioprocessing systems. Unlike traditional batch processes, which involve stopping and starting production at different stages, continuous bioprocessing enables a seamless and uninterrupted flow of materials throughout the entire production cycle. This results in higher productivity, faster turnaround times, and better control over product quality.
